Providing your furry friend with optimal digestive health is crucial for their overall well-being. A balanced diet and regular exercise are essential foundations, but sometimes our canine companions need a little extra support. Digestive supplements can play a vital role in promoting healthy digestion, reducing discomfort, and improving nutrient absorption.

There's a broad variety of supplements available designed for dogs, each with its own unique benefits. Some popular choices include probiotics, which help replenish beneficial gut bacteria; prebiotics, which nourish those good bacteria; and enzymes that aid in the breakdown of food.

Hot Spot Relief: Effective Treatments for Your Pup's Skin Rashes

Dealing with a hot spot on your furry friend can be stressful, but knowing the right treatments can make all the difference. These painful and red skin lesions often appear suddenly and require prompt attention. While prevention is always best, understanding what causes hot spots and how to effectively manage them is crucial for keeping your pup comfortable. First and foremost, it's essential to restrict your dog from licking or biting the area, as this can worsen inflammation and introduce bacteria. A cone or elizabethan collar can be helpful in deterring your pup from scratching. Next, thoroughly clean the hot spot with a gentle povidone-iodine to remove dirt and debris. Once cleaned, apply check here an appropriate topical ointment prescribed by your veterinarian. These can help reduce inflammation, fight infection, and promote healing.
